Multiverse Computing raises $570M Series C at $1.7B valuation for LLM compression tech
Spanish AI startup Multiverse Computing has raised a $570 million Series C funding round at a $1.7 billion valuation, according to the company. The startup specializes in compressing large language models to reduce their energy consumption and computational costs, targeting enterprise customers seeking more efficient AI deployment.
This funding event is notable for its magnitude — $570 million is a substantial sum for an efficiency-layer player rather than a foundation model lab. The round validates the thesis that as enterprises scale LLM adoption, they increasingly face prohibitive inference costs, creating demand for model compression and optimization solutions that sit between the foundation model and the deployment environment. Multiverse Computing's approach directly addresses the growing tension between model capability and operational expense.
From a market structure perspective, this signals that capital allocators are betting on the "inference cost crisis" as a durable business opportunity. Rather than competing with frontier labs on model quality, Multiverse Computing positions itself as a layer that extracts value from existing models by making them cheaper to run — a pattern reminiscent of how middleware companies captured value in prior enterprise software cycles. The $1.7 billion valuation suggests the market expects this compression layer to become a standard part of enterprise AI infrastructure.
